Bank Leumi App Now Available in Five Languages
Bank Leumi has launched a five-language mobile app supporting Hebrew, English, Arabic, Russian, and French, accompanied by a new advertising campaign starring Gal Toren.

Bank Leumi, led by CEO Hanan Friedman, has announced that its mobile application is now available in five different languages: Hebrew, English, Arabic, Russian, and French. As part of this initiative, customers can easily select their preferred language within the app, providing a more accessible and efficient digital banking experience.
Extended Digital Banking Services
Among the transactions and services available across these languages are checking account balances in both shekels and foreign currency, ordering credit cards and checkbooks, making multi-currency transfers, ZAHAV (RTGS) wire transfers, foreign exchange conversions, opening deposits, and taking out loans. The bank noted that additional services and features will be added to these languages in the near stage.
To promote the new update, Bank Leumi launched an advertising campaign featuring actor and musician Gal Toren. In a series of comedic sketches, Toren highlights everyday social situations familiar to new immigrants, contrasting the challenges of navigating Israeli culture with the seamless ease of using the Bank Leumi app in five native languages. The advertising campaign was handled by the McCann Tel Aviv agency.

Campaign Insights and Strategy
Bank representatives explained that the campaign stems from a simple insight: many Israelis frequently speak languages other than Hebrew, even after living in the country for many years. The core challenge of the project was turning a purely functional digital upgrade into a human, humorous, and relatable campaign that highlights financial inclusion and ease of use.
